html
unity加载图片到本地文件路径
一、unity加载图片到本地文件路径
如何在Unity中加载图片到本地文件路径
Unity是一款功能强大的跨平台游戏开发引擎,许多开发人员选择使用Unity来开发各种类型的游戏和应用程序。在Unity中,加载图片并将其保存到本地文件路径是一个常见的需求,本文将介绍如何在Unity中实现这一功能。
使用Unity加载图片
要在Unity中加载图片,首先需要将图片资源导入到项目中。可以通过拖拽图片文件到Unity编辑器窗口中来导入图片资源。然后可以使用Unity的API来加载这些图片资源,例如使用Resources.Load()
方法。
保存图片到本地文件路径
保存图片到本地文件路径可以通过Unity的File.WriteAllBytes()
方法来实现。这个方法可以将二进制数据写入到文件中,因此可以将图片的二进制数据保存到本地文件中。
以下是一个简单的示例代码,演示了如何加载图片资源并将其保存到本地文件路径:
public void SaveImageToLocalPath(Texture2D image, string filePath)
{
byte[] bytes = image.EncodeToPNG();
File.WriteAllBytes(filePath, bytes);
}
示例:加载图片到本地文件路径
下面是一个完整的示例,演示了如何在Unity中加载图片并将其保存到本地文件路径的过程:
using UnityEngine;
using System.IO;
public class ImageLoader : MonoBehaviour
{
public Texture2D imageToLoad;
public string localFilePath;
private void Start()
{
// 加载图片资源
Texture2D image = Resources.Load("Images/exampleImage");
// 保存图片到本地文件路径
SaveImageToLocalPath(image, localFilePath);
}
private void SaveImageToLocalPath(Texture2D image, string filePath)
{
byte[] bytes = image.EncodeToPNG();
File.WriteAllBytes(filePath, bytes);
Debug.Log("Image saved to local path: " + filePath);
}
}
总结
在Unity中加载图片并保存到本地文件路径是一项常见的任务,通过本文介绍的方法,您可以轻松实现这一功能。记得在使用File.WriteAllBytes()
方法保存图片时,要确保路径的合法性,并处理好相关的异常情况,以确保程序的稳定性。
二、pdfobject如何加载不是本地的路径的文件?
下载源码;
1、找到 com.nostra13.universalimageloader.core.LoadAndDisplayImageTask 类 ;
2、tryLoadBitmap() 方法;
3、imageUriForDecoding 这个变量;
4、在 bitmap = decodeImage(imageUriForDecoding); 前 添加 imageUriForDecoding = Uri.decode
(imageUriForDecoding.toString());
刚踩的坑,自问自答一下;
三、jquery加载本地文件
jquery加载本地文件是一种常见的前端开发需求,无论是用于读取本地存储中的数据,还是展示用户上传的文件内容,都可以通过jQuery实现这一功能。本文将介绍如何使用jQuery加载本地文件,并提供简单示例帮助读者快速上手。
如何使用jQuery加载本地文件
要实现通过jQuery加载本地文件,可以借助JavaScript的File API来处理文件操作。首先,需要在页面中引入jQuery库:
<script src="jquery-3.6.0.min.js"></script>然后,在JavaScript代码中编写文件读取的逻辑。以下是一个简单的示例:
$(document).ready(function() { $('#fileInput').change(function(e) { var file = e.target.files[0]; var reader = new FileReader(); reader.onload = function(e) { var content = e.target.result; $('#fileContent').text(content); }; reader.readAsText(file); }); });
在上面的示例中,当用户选择文件后,会触发change事件,读取文件内容并将其显示在id为fileContent的元素中。
示例演示
以下是一个简单的示例,演示了如何使用jQuery加载本地文件并展示文件内容:
<input type="file" id="fileInput"> <p id="fileContent"></p>
在以上示例中,用户可以点击选择文件按钮,选择本地文件后,文件内容将会显示在页面中。
注意事项
在开发过程中,需要注意以下几点:
- 安全性:在加载本地文件时,要考虑潜在的安全风险,避免恶意文件的执行。
- 错误处理:在文件读取过程中,要做好错误处理,确保程序稳定性。
- 兼容性:不同浏览器对于文件操作的支持有所差异,需要根据需求进行兼容性处理。
通过以上几点的注意,可以更好地实现使用jQuery加载本地文件的功能,并提升用户体验。
结语
总的来说,jquery加载本地文件是一个常见但有挑战的前端任务。通过本文的介绍和示例,相信读者对于如何使用jQuery加载本地文件有了更清晰的认识。在实际开发中,可以根据具体需求进行进一步的扩展和优化,提升页面交互性和功能完整性。
四、本地的html怎么直接通过路径就读取本地文件?
要引入图片就<img src="a.jpg" alt=""> src里是你想引入的本地图片的相对路径,也就是相对于你这个html文件,它在什么位置,如果在同一个文件夹下,就像我这样直接引就可以了,如果在上一级目录,就“../a.jpg”再上一级就再加个"../"。引入css和js文件类似,只不过标签不一样,引css用<link rel="stylesheet">js,用<script>标签
五、火狐用本地html加载swf?
这是FLASH播放器的安全限制
在发布SWF文件的时候可以选择 仅访问网络、仅访问本地。
当你这个FLASH肯定是只能访问本地网络,所以当有链接要访问网络的时候就会有警告。
试想,如果你打开一个FLASH,他可以访问的本地硬盘文件,他还可以访问网络,那么他不是不可以随意下载任意内容到你电脑,或者上传内容到网络上?
解决办法1 将网页上传到服务器 通过网络环境访问
2,发布SWF的时候在设置里面 设置为 仅访问本地文件
六、怎么用WebView加载本地html?
本人已解决,效果还不错,流畅性已经和原生APP差不多了,可以:
1、右滑动返回上一页,左滑进入详情页2、秒开新页,秒回上一页3、支持动画切换页面4、图片加载支持百分比进度条5、无限历史记录(也可设置为保持N个页)
实现原理是:
1、单页面2、本地缓存模板并进行版本管理3、ajax加载json数据 和图片4、堆栈管理历史记录
七、html怎么跨文件指定路径?
在当前页面,每../返回上一级,返回多级就多个../,./表示当前目录,./../表示当前目录的上级目录,./../../当前目录的上级的上级目录。
八、HTML5如何获取文件路径?
html通过file获取文件路径方法:
File f = new File(this.getClass().getResource("/").getPath());
System.out.println(f);
结果:
C:\Documents%20and%20Settings\Administrator\workspace\projectName\bin
获取当前类的所在工程路径;
如果不加“/”
File f = new File(this.getClass().getResource("").getPath());
System.out.println(f);
结果:
C:\Documents%20and%20Settings\Administrator\workspace\projectName\bin\com\test
获取当前类的绝对路径;
九、如何使用JavaScript加载本地JSON文件
JavaScript是一种强大的脚本语言,可以用于网站开发、数据可视化等各种应用场景。在前端开发中,我们经常需要加载和使用本地的JSON文件。本文将介绍一种简单的方法,让你轻松地使用JavaScript加载本地JSON文件。
什么是JSON?
J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,常用于前端和后端之间的数据传输。它使用键值对的形式来表示数据,可以包含数组、嵌套对象等复杂结构。
为什么要加载本地JSON文件?
加载本地JSON文件可以方便地获取静态数据,比如配置文件、语言包、示例数据等。这样可以减少对服务器的请求,提高网页加载速度,并且方便离线使用。
使用XMLHttpRequest加载本地JSON文件
XMLHttpRequest是JavaScript中用于发送HTTP请求的对象,可以用来加载本地JSON文件。
- 首先创建一个XMLHttpRequest对象:
- 设置请求方法和URL:
- 设置响应类型为JSON:
- 发送请求:
- 在请求完成时,处理返回的JSON数据:
var xhr = new XMLHttpRequest();
xhr.open('GET', 'example.json', true);
xhr.responseType = 'json';
xhr.send();
xhr.onload = function() {
if (xhr.status === 200) {
var jsonData = xhr.response;
// 使用jsonData做进一步的处理
}
};
使用fetch API加载本地JSON文件
fetch是一个新的网络请求API,比XMLHttpRequest更简洁易用。它可以发送GET请求来加载本地JSON文件。
- 使用fetch函数发送GET请求:
fetch('example.json')
.then(function(response) {
return response.json();
})
.then(function(jsonData) {
// 使用jsonData做进一步的处理
});
注意事项
在使用JavaScript加载本地JSON文件时,需要注意以下几点:
- 确保JSON文件的格式正确,可以使用在线JSON验证工具进行验证。
- 在进行异步操作时,需要处理加载失败和异常情况。
- 遵循同源策略,即 JavaScript 只能从与其所在的 HTML 页面位于同一个域名下的服务器上加载 JSON 文件。
通过上述方法,你可以轻松地使用JavaScript加载本地JSON文件,方便地获取静态数据,并在前端应用中进行进一步的处理。希望本文能帮助到你,谢谢阅读!
十、在网页如何连接本地html文件?
需要准备的材料分别有:电脑、浏览器、html编辑器。
1、首先,打开html编辑器,新建html文件,例如:index.html。
2、在index.html中的
标签中,输入html代码:。3、浏览器运行index.html页面,此时添加的本地图片的路径是相对路径。
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...